1999年杭嘉湖平原一次连续暴雨过程诊断分析 被引量:2

摘要 用新的曲面拟合法 (NMOCSF)对江淮和杭嘉湖平原一次连续暴雨过程作物理诊断 ,结合天气形势讨论了准静止华北高压的形成及其对江淮和杭嘉湖平原连续暴雨的贡献。指出 ,当江淮和杭嘉湖平原处在梅雨期时 ,应特别注意华北高压的强度和位置 ,一旦构成阻塞形势 ,就极可能发生大范围、持续性的强降水过程。 A continuous heavy rain process at Jianghuai and Hangjiahu plains is diagnosed with a new method of curved surface fitting (NMOCSF). Some valuable standpoints are presented. Combining with the weather situation, the formation of the quasi stationary North China high and its contribution to the continuous heavy rain process over Jianghuai and Hangjiahu plains are discussed. It is pointed out that special attention should be given to the intensity and the position of the quasi stationary North China high during the Meiyu season around Jianghuai and Hangjiahu plains. Once the block up feature forms, a continuous heavy rain process will probably takes place in a large area.
